Transaction 03d6429550a0d84b8aa4b9673a77a35920f0fb8e3ea87bba71aaa0ecc24b1775

31 Input
2 Outputs
  • 03d6429550a0d84b8aa4b9673a77a35920f0fb8e3ea87bba71aaa0ecc24b1775:0
  • value  66647
    address  1DCHhfA1nhNzHnhsh37kAgcrk24vxK9suS
  • 03d6429550a0d84b8aa4b9673a77a35920f0fb8e3ea87bba71aaa0ecc24b1775:1
  • value  23810000
    address  1FaWEAsRZefQGfV5Z6id8V5FzYB6LU8ySd